Output 81c8dc0604d32c1e11b7f70b4e9d4b122aa8eb75c43d740bc6adc4d6660926d9:1

value
90760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 728ece3fd4f611b4904313c63797cc92442cc0e7 OP_EQUAL
address
3C8k2ivtWV5bDnQkHxB6EKYWe6QwoLyF6c
transaction
81c8dc0604d32c1e11b7f70b4e9d4b122aa8eb75c43d740bc6adc4d6660926d9
confirmations
223148
spent
true